Default Bitchin' about Audi of America (Repost)

<br>In my short term as an owner of an A4, I have come to the simple conclusion that Audi of America is just a poorly run company. It seems to me<br>that they care little about the "enthusiast" driver that this car is built for, and cater more to all the soccer moms that can't tell an accelerator from a<br>brake pedal.<p>I can understand that A of A must be careful because of their past problems, but their lack of options and support that they give to Audi owners is<br>remarkable. Compared to BMW of America, this company seems to be almost comatose. BMW offers its customers a full range of accessory<br>items, everything from key rings, to body mods (not to mentions tons of OEM wheel options). In addition, BMW allows its customers to upgrade<br>their automobiles from certified Dinan shops.<p>Now, the lack of ALL of these services would not upset me so much if Audi of America did not have any of these resources available to them.<br>However, with the availability of a full line Quattro GmbH accessories to European owners, and a very close relationship with MTM, I find it<br>inexcusable that Audi has chosen to ignore the "enthusiast".<p>Granted, A of A offers us a very nice selection of coffee books and videos, but if they really want to keep me as a repeat buyer they must step up<br>their service and support after purchase.<p>Anybody feel like filing an electronic petition to A of A?<p>-Stu Koch<br>99 2.8qts
